核桃叶生物活性成分的研究(Ⅰ)

摘要
本论文对植物化感作用的研究概况和核桃属植物化学成分及生物活性研究进展作简要综述,并对核桃叶中乙酸乙酯部分和石油醚提取物化学成分进行了研究,以及乙醇浸膏、乙酸乙酯浸膏和化合物Ⅱ的化感活性、化合物Ⅱ的抑菌活性进行了测定分析。
     采用溶剂提取、柱层析分离等方法,得到2个黄酮醇类化合物,经物理常数测定,化学定性反应和光谱测定(~1HNMR,~(13)CNMR,IR,UV,EI-MS,FAB-MS,HSQC),化合物Ⅱ鉴定为山柰酚-3-O-α-L-呋喃阿拉伯糖苷,初步确定化合物Ⅰ是山柰酚;通过种子发芽及生长试验,测定出乙酸乙酯浸膏部分在浓度Ⅲ(0.019g.ml~(-1))时,化感活性(抑制)作用最强,化合物Ⅱ则表现出低促(200μg·ml~(-1))高抑(800μg·ml~(-1))的效果;化合物Ⅱ在100μg·ml~(-1)时对枯草杆菌有较高的杀菌活性,在三种浓度下(100μg·ml~(-1),200μg·ml~(-1),400μg·ml~(-1))对金黄色葡萄球菌、大肠杆菌、康氏木霉有微弱的杀菌活性,而对青霉和黄曲霉无杀菌活性;核桃叶石油醚提取物经GC-MS分析鉴定出13种化合物,其含量为总量的73.486%。文献报道胡桃醌是已知核桃属植物起化感作用的物质,本研究结果首次表明:黄酮醇类化合物也是核桃叶中的化感物质。这为开发新型环保生物源农药(如除草剂)提供了新的依据,同时也为核桃叶这一丰富的再生资源的开发利用开辟了一条新的途径。
Two flavonoides were isolated from the dried leaves of Juglans regia. Their chemical structures were elucidated as kaempferol(I), kaempferol-3-0-arafuranoside (II), respectively, by means of spctroscopic analysis(1 HMMR,13CMMR, IR, UV, EI-MS, FAB-MS, HSQC), chemical reaction, and by companon of the spectral data of the known compounds. It was found that ethylacetate extract significantly inhibited lettuce seed germination, root and seedling growth at concentration 111(0.019g-ml-1), indicating that that ethylacetate part had potent allelopathy. Compound II promoted the lettuce growth at low concentration (200 g-ml-1)and inhibited the growth at high concentration (800 g-mT-1). Compound II showed excellent fungicidal activities against Bacillus subtilis at the dosage of 100 g-ml-1, weak effect against Staphylococcus auraeus , Trichodermin. E.coli at the dosage of 100 g-ml-1, 200 g-ml-1, 400 g-ml-1, and inactive to Penicillium sp and Aspergillus sp. Thirteen compounds from petroleumether extract were identified by GC-MS, and the content amounts to 73.486% in total. Juglone has been considered to be the major allelochemical ofjuglans plants in the past years, but our studies firstly show that flavonoides are important allelochemicals in the leaves ofjuglans regia. This will offer new evidence for exploiting environment-friendly herbicides.
